Men's Squash Team Finishes Off 2-0 Opening Day with 7-2 Victory at Boston University

Sophomore Gordon Silverman won a competitive four-game match at #4

BOSTON - The Tufts men's squash team earned a 7-2 victory at Boston University on Saturday afternoon to post a 2-0 record on the opening day of the 2012-13 season. The Jumbos had an earlier 9-0 win against Vermont.

Tufts, ranked 27th in the Dunlop Preseason Team Rankings, won the top seven matches against #48 BU. Jumbos won the first three matches in three games, and of the four other victories three were in four games and one went five.

Freshman Brandon Weiss (Phoenix, MD) won the most competitive match of the day at #5. He was down two games against Jonathan Chambers before rallying to take the match with 11-5, 11-6, and 11-5 wins. Jumbo sophomore Elliot Kardon (Weston, MA) broke a 1-1 tie in the seventh match with 11-1 wins in the third and fourth for a victory.

Sophomore co-captain Zach Schweitzer (Huntingdon Valley, PA) defeated BU's Chaiyatat Ben Bunjapamai 11-8, 11-1, 11-3 in the #1 match.

The Jumbos will wrap up the weekend with a match against #33 Boston College at MIT on Sunday afternoon.
